Understanding The Benefits Of Shooting In Raw With The Lumix G85

Shooting in Raw format with the Lumix G85 offers a plethora of benefits for photographers, unlocking the camera’s full potential. Unlike shooting in JPEG, Raw preserves all the original data captured by the camera’s sensor, providing unparalleled flexibility and control during post-processing.

One of the primary advantages of shooting in Raw is the ability to recover lost details in both overexposed and underexposed areas of the image. This is particularly crucial in high-contrast situations where preserving highlight and shadow details is essential. By having access to the full range of information captured by the sensor, photographers can make precise adjustments to exposure, contrast, and white balance without degrading image quality.

Additionally, shooting in Raw allows for non-destructive editing. Unlike JPEG, Raw files are not processed in-camera, giving photographers the freedom to experiment with various settings and creative choices later on. This flexibility is especially vital for professionals who require maximum control over their images. Whether it’s adjusting colors, enhancing sharpness, or reducing noise, Raw files grant photographers the ability to achieve their desired results with unmatched precision.

Furthermore, shooting in Raw ensures the preservation of image quality over time. Raw files contain more data and carry less compression artifacts compared to JPEG. This means that even years down the line, photographers can revisit their Raw files and produce higher-quality images with the advancements in post-processing technology.

How To Shoot Raw Images With Lumix G85: Step-by-Step Guide

The Lumix G85’s raw shooting capabilities open up a world of possibilities for photographers. Shooting in raw format allows you to capture and preserve all the data from the camera’s sensor, providing maximum flexibility during the post-processing stage.

To shoot raw images with the Lumix G85, follow these simple steps:

1. Set the camera to raw mode: Go to the camera’s shooting menu and select “RAW” as the image quality setting. This ensures that the camera captures images in raw format.

2. Adjust exposure settings: Use the camera’s exposure controls to set the desired aperture, shutter speed, and ISO for your shot. Keep in mind that shooting in raw gives you more latitude in adjusting exposure in post-processing, so you can experiment with different settings.

3. Frame your shot: Compose your image using the camera’s viewfinder or LCD screen. Take your time to ensure that all elements are properly framed and in focus.

4. Capture the image: Press the shutter button to capture the raw image. The Lumix G85’s advanced autofocus system ensures accurate and fast focusing, so you can capture sharp images.

5. Transfer the raw files: After shooting, transfer the raw files from the memory card to your computer for post-processing. Use a reliable memory card reader or connect your camera directly to the computer.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Does the Lumix G85 have the capability to shoot in Raw format?

Yes, the Lumix G85 is equipped with the ability to shoot in Raw format, allowing photographers to capture images with higher detail and greater flexibility in post-processing.

2. What are the advantages of shooting Raw with the Lumix G85?

Shooting in Raw with the Lumix G85 offers several advantages, including the ability to retain more information in the image, adjust white balance and exposure more accurately, and recover greater details in shadows and highlights.

3. Can I shoot both Raw and JPEG simultaneously with the Lumix G85?

Absolutely! The Lumix G85 allows you to shoot in both Raw and JPEG formats simultaneously, giving you the flexibility to quickly share JPEGs while still having the option to further enhance your images in Raw.

4. What software can I use to process Raw files from the Lumix G85?

The Lumix G85’s Raw files can be processed using various software programs such as Adobe Lightroom, Capture One, or Panasonic’s own software, Silkypix Developer Studio. These programs offer powerful tools for editing and optimizing Raw images.
